President Tinubu has ordered an extensive manhunt for those responsible, as leaders nationwide call for justice. The victims, who identified themselves as hunters, were traveling in a Dangote Cement truck when local security forces stopped them in the Udune Efandion community.

After discovering dane guns in the vehicle, vigilantes raised suspicions, leading to a mob attack. Disturbing videos circulating online show the victims pleading for their lives before being brutally killed and set ablaze, while some bystanders continued their daily routines.

Eyewitness accounts suggest the travelers were mistaken for kidnappers, as tensions rose in a community plagued by frequent abductions. Despite police intervention, 16 people lost their lives, while 14 suspects have been arrested.

In response, President Tinubu condemned the act of jungle justice and directed security agencies to ensure those responsible are brought to justice. The Northern States Governors’ Forum (NSGF) and prominent figures, including former Vice President Atiku Abubakar, have also demanded accountability and emphasized the importance of safeguarding citizens’ rights.
